Output 68dbacabefa2a634e65327c895f16e4ec725a8037979b312773e09797fc01384:30

value
76601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a552679858dd7d102435a4036b98ba16e6c13f3 OP_EQUAL
address
38U3w5trmxjCkbYNmyWi6yEUsi8U8AQ6fa
transaction
68dbacabefa2a634e65327c895f16e4ec725a8037979b312773e09797fc01384